It's so nice to be able to show you where I live. I suppose I should get talking about today's sunny project which is also very pretty:
I used the Kinda Eclectic stamp set (available in Wood Mount and Clear Mount) and stamped the sunshine stamp in Daffodil Delight, which is a cheery colour. I used the Labeler Alphabet to create the sentiment 'Happy Birthday'. I finished the card off with some Solid White Baker's Twine, which is probably one of my favourite accessories in the catalogue.
